Background: The Chevrolet Sonic's fuel pump module (AFPAParts20 AF116912P03) is a critical component of the vehicle's fuel system. When this part fails, it may lead to several issues, such as poor fuel economy, no start condition, or stalling. Replacing the faulty fuel pump module can help resolve these problems. Cons of buying a Fuel Pump Module:1. Cost: Replacing the fuel pump module can be an expensive repair, with the part costing about $250-$350, not including labor fees.
2. Time: The process of diagnosing the issue, purchasing the part, and installing it may take several hours at a professional repair shop or even longer if you choose to do it yourself.
3. Complexity: Replacing the fuel pump module might be a more complicated process compared to other repairs due to its position in the fuel tank and the potential for fuel spillage during the replacement procedure.
